1990 Toyota Corrolla Wont Start

To clarify, if it cranks but won't start, the starter is doing its job.
If it cranks but won't start, you'll need to figure out if it is a fuel or ignition problem to proceed.
You can have someone check the fuel line for pressure and spark at the plugs.
